ABSTRACT A method of adding propulsive force to an ice breaker in the process of breaking the ice in a frozen sea by allowing her hull to ride on it which is characterized by utilizing a strongly tractive force of a winch. In this method, a pile is first put up, and then, the cable connected with the pile is winded up by the winch according to the advance of the ship. This method may save the fuel, and shorten the breaking time.
